What is a white bread award?

Costa Book Awards, formerly Whitbread Literary Awards (1971–84), Whitbread Book Awards (1985–2005), series of literary awards given annually to writers resident in the United Kingdom and Ireland for books published there in the previous year. The awards are administered by the British Booksellers Association.

What are the Costa Book Awards and why are they important?

The Costa Book Awards are a set of annual literary awards recognising English-language books by writers based in Britain and Ireland. They were inaugurated for 1971 publications and known as the Whitbread Book Awards until 2006 when Costa Coffee, then a subsidiary of Whitbread, took over sponsorship.

How much do Costa Book of the Year winners get paid?

Each of the five winning writers receives £5,000. The prize requires a £5,000 fee from publishers if a book is to be shortlisted. One of the winning books is then named Costa Book of the Year with a further £30,000 prize. That overall award is determined by a panel comprising five judges from the first round and four new ones.
